Conserving Evidence

You must preserve evidence if you are involved in a motorbike accident. This will allow your lawyer to build a convincing case against you. Your lawyer must show that the other driver was the one responsible for the accident, and that their negligence caused you injuries.

You should keep a variety of evidence such as photographs, declarations by witnesses , and physical objects. Photos are helpful because they can help you determine the circumstances of the crash. They can also help you record your injuries, road conditions, and other factors that might have influenced your case.

Statements from witnesses to the accident, like emergency medical personnel, are an crucial evidence. These statements can provide valuable information regarding the crash and its causes.

In addition, police reports can be helpful as well. They can contain information regarding visibility conditions, vehicle locations at the scene, as well as the extent of the damage.

Another type of evidence you need to collect is medical records, which can be useful in proving your injury. It will also prove that you received treatment or rehabilitation.

It is also important to keep records of all expenses and charges in connection with your injuries. This can assist your attorney determine the amount you should be compensated for your damages.

Making a Notice of Claim

You could be able to file a claim against the driver who is at fault, or their insurance company if are hurt in a motorcycle accident. These claims aren't simple to pursue as they require time to analyze and negotiate. It's important to consult an New York motorcycle injury lawyer immediately to safeguard your rights and receive the compensation you're due.

The first step in any claim is to submit a claim notice with the governmental entity responsible for the damage. The general rule is that a claim must be filed within a specified time frame (usually three to six months) to allow a lawsuit to be started against the governmental entity. If an exception is not made by statute or ordinance, a plaintiff cannot bring a lawsuit in the event that they fail to submit a claim.

A notice of claim must be written and signed by an official notary public. It should contain the date and time of the incident, along with the circumstances surrounding it, the name of the plaintiff, his address, as well as the nature and the basis of the claim.

It must be handed over personally to the government entity or registered or certified mail to a person designated by law to receive services for the public corporation. The Notice of Claim must be served on the government agency within 30 days of the filing date. Negotiating a Settlement

It is crucial to hire an experienced lawyer should you be involved in a motorcycle accident. This will help you navigate the legal system, and ensure that you get the settlement you're entitled to. This includes medical bills, lost earnings, and other expenses related to accidents.

Your attorney can negotiate a settlement with the at fault insurer to collect the entire amount of compensation that you are entitled to. If needed, they could represent you in court.

Most civil cases can be settled without having to go to trial. This often saves the parties a significant amount of time and money.

Settlements are more equitable than trials and more likely to lead to an outcome that is favorable for plaintiffs. While a lawsuit may be an effective way to reach an agreement, it may also pose financial risk and liability.

The key to negotiating a settlement is to take your case seriously and to be patient. An experienced attorney can help you negotiate a settlement fast.

During negotiations, you will receive various offers from the insurance company as well as the at-fault party. Each of these offers will differ and will be determined by your specific injuries or medical expenses as well as losses.

Many people accept settlements that are not enough to cover their costs. Insurance companies know that most people don't understand the extent of their injuries or their chances of recovering.

These settlement offers can be managed by a competent lawyer, resulting in more compensation for motorcyclists injured. Lawyers have connections and know-how with medical experts and accident reconstructionists.

If you have a solid base for your claim, your attorney will work to prove that the insurance company's offer is not fair. They will employ various strategies to convince the insurance company to raise the amount of money it will offer.

Going to Court

If the at-fault driver and the insurance company refuse to fairly settle your motorcycle accident claim and you are unable to settle it, you could have to go to the court. Although it is a process that can be complex and time-consuming, it is the only way to obtain fair compensation for your injuries and losses.

The severity of your injuries, along with other aspects of the situation, will determine whether you need to go to court. A knowledgeable lawyer can help you analyze your case and decide if you want to seek a settlement or proceed to trial.

It is essential to take every step possible to preserve evidence before you go to court. This includes writing down your personal report of the accident and recording any witness statements and taking photos of the scene.

These steps are more likely to help you repair economic and non-economic damage if you act quickly. These include medical bills , lost wages along with property damage, emotional and psychological trauma, and loss of earnings.

It is also crucial to seek out a reputable personal injury attorney who specializes in motorcycle accidents. They can help you determine the value of your claim and pursue the most amount of compensation for your loss.

You might be able file a product liability suit against the manufacturer if the incident was caused due to a defective component of your motorcycle. They could be held accountable in the event that the manufacturer was aware of the defect and should have warned about it.

Another party responsible for your accident could be the government, especially in the event that you were struck by an accident caused by a pothole or a negligent driver. A reliable New York motorcycle accident attorney can identify these parties and pursue their responsibility to compensate for your losses.

In certain situations there are instances where financial recovery could be possible through your own uninsured or underinsured coverage. This is an additional layer of insurance that safeguards the driver who is at fault which makes it easier for them to receive fair and appropriate compensation.
